FUJIFILM Integrated Inkjet Solutions Appoints Ankur Mour to VP and GM

Mour has directed and managed the group’s long-term strategic vision, operational plans, and processes.

FUJIFILM Integrated Inkjet Solutions announces that effective immediately, Ankur Mour will serve as VP and GM.

Mour is a Fujifilm veteran, serving in progressively senior roles for numerous functions, including engineering, manufacturing operations, commercial presales, customer support, ink development, and project management.

During his tenure at FUJIFILM Integrated Inkjet Solutions, Mour directed and managed the group’s long-term strategic vision, operational plans, and processes. He played a pivotal role in the development and launch of recent products such as the 42X Printbar System, DE1024 Embellishment System and the Dimatix Materials Printer DMP-2850 S.

Mour also led the successful deployment of Fujifilm’s global business platforms, processes, and practices at the European offices of FUJIFILM Integrated Inkjet Solutions, ensuring alignment with the company’s corporate goals and strategic objectives. In his new role, he will lead a global team of dynamic professionals in bringing high-quality digital inkjet to Fujifilm’s global customer network.

“I am honored to be entrusted with the leadership of the FUJIFILM Integrated Inkjet Solutions team at such a dynamic and pivotal time for the company,” says Mour. “Fujifilm’s dedication to innovation and excellence in digital inkjet printing technology is truly inspiring. I look forward to leading our talented team to enhance our capabilities and bring our world-class solutions to new markets and applications.”
